Celebrating Cagayan de Oro (CDO) City’s Higalaay Festival, PLDT and Smart Communications, Inc. (Smart), through its value brand TNT, recently partnered with the local government to bring a grander fiesta experience for Kagay-anons. Thousands joined the revelry, particularly the colorful street dancing competition, which featured TNT endorser and matinee idol Joshua Garcia. 

“We sincerely express our gratitude to PLDT, Smart and TNT for bringing happiness to Kagay-anons, through Joshua Garcia, as we celebrated the Higalaay Festival in honor of our beloved patron saint, Sr. San Agustin,” said CDO City Mayor Rolando “Klarex” Uy. 

Despite daily rains, crowds stayed to enjoy the lively performances of the street dancers, along with exciting activities held all over the city, including the International Dragon Boat Competition, Civic Military Parade and Float Competition, and the much-anticipated Miss Cagayan de Oro pageant. 

For many, this year’s Higalaay Festival reignited the spirit of golden friendship (panaghigalaay) that the city has been known for. Kagay-anon Mike John Paul Caña, who enjoyed the street dancing competition with friends, shared, “The fiesta showcases our city’s vibrant culture, but what truly made this experience memorable is how it strengthened our friendship and sense of unity.”
